Delay update

I spoke with MiniUSA late this afternoon and again soon before they shut down for the night to see if my car has moved off the dock (it hasn't). The two different people I spoke with each told me that the delay is due to several large shipments all arriving within a short time which ended up dumping about 4000 (four thousand) cars (both Minis & BMWs) onto the dock that need to go through the VPC.

Apparently a number of Minis went out on the 21st & 22nd but if your car wasn't in that group it will probably be the middle of next week before leaving the VPC.

Truth or fiction?
